Women's Work: The First 20,000 Years Women, Cloth, and Society in Early Times

Women's Work: The First 20,000 Years Women, Cloth, and Society in Early Times more books like this

by Elizabeth Wayland Barber

2500 years ago, the women of Athens slaved at home, virtual prisoners of their husbands, expected to provide the cloth and clothing for their family. 4000 years ago in ancient Mesopotamia, there was a very different picture: respectable women were in business, weaving textiles at home to be sold abroad for gold and silver. Simply Seminole

Simply Seminole more books like this

by Dorothy Hanisko, Hanisko Dorothy

Created by the Native Americans of southern Florida, Seminole strip piecing is based on a simple form of decorative patchwork. It is a quilting technique perfectly geared for today's tools, fabrics, and lifestyles - a technique that rewards busy quilters with magnificent results in record time. Wearing Propaganda: Textiles on the Home Front in Japan, Britain, and the United States, 1931-1945

Wearing Propaganda: Textiles on the Home Front in Japan, Britain, and the United States, 1931-1945 more books like this

by Jacqueline M Atkins (Editor)

Protest fashion from the Vietnam War years is widely familiar, but today few are aware that dramatic fashion and textile designs served as patriotic propaganda for the Japanese, British, and Americans during the Asia-Pacific War (1931-1945).
